What Does P2287 Mean?
The injector control pressure (ICP) sensor signal is erratic or dropping out intermittently. This typically affects diesel engines with high-pressure common rail or HEUI injection systems where precise pressure monitoring is critical for injection timing and fuel delivery.
Common Causes
35%
Faulty ICP sensor with internal intermittent failure or contamination
30%
Corroded, loose, or damaged wiring/connector at ICP sensor
20%
Intermittent short or open in sensor circuit due to chafing or vibration damage
10%
PCM/ECM internal fault affecting sensor signal processing
5%
Contaminated fuel causing erratic pressure spikes affecting sensor readings
Diagnostic Steps
1
Step 1: Monitor ICP sensor live data while wiggling harness/connector to identify intermittent connection issues
2
Step 2: Inspect ICP sensor connector for corrosion, pin fit, and moisture intrusion; clean and apply dielectric grease if needed
3
Step 3: Check sensor circuit resistance and voltage supply per manufacturer specifications; compare to known-good values
4
Step 4: Scope ICP sensor signal looking for dropouts, noise, or erratic patterns during key-on and cranking
5
Step 5: If wiring and connections are good, replace ICP sensor and verify proper pressure readings
